Oceanic crust is created as magma rises to fill the gap between diverging tectonic plates and is consumed in subduction zones. It is geologically young, with a mean age of 60 Ma, and is thin, averaging 6.5 km in thickness. Oceanic crust consists almost exclusively of extrusive basalt and its intrusive equivalents.
